What are Data Integration Tools for Linux?

Data integration tools help organizations combine data from multiple sources into a unified, coherent system for analysis and decision-making. These tools streamline the process of gathering, transforming, and loading data (ETL) from various databases, applications, and cloud services, ensuring consistent data across platforms. They provide features like data cleansing, mapping, and real-time synchronization, ensuring data accuracy and reliability. With automated workflows and connectors, data integration tools reduce manual effort and eliminate data silos, improving operational efficiency. Ultimately, they enable businesses to make better, data-driven decisions by providing a comprehensive view of their information landscape.     Etlworks is a modern, cloud-first, any-to-any data integration platform that scales with the business. It can connect to business applications, databases, and structured, semi-structured, and unstructured data of any type, shape, and size. You can create, test, and schedule very complex data integration and automation scenarios and data integration APIs in no time, right in the browser, using an intuitive drag-and-drop interface, scripting languages, and SQL. Etlworks supports real-time change data capture (CDC) from all major databases, EDI transformations, and many other fundamental data integration tasks.
